A restoration version of Shakespeare's last play, with music by Henry Purcell, Matthew Locke, Pelham Humfrey, Giovanni Battista Draghi and others. Includes settings of Arise, ye subterranean winds and Full fathom five, both formerly attributed to Purcell

Recorded: Henry Wood Hall, London, 11/1995
20 Bit BITSTREAM recording

40-page booklet in English, German and French, including texts and notes on the music.
